I have it, and I have "My Fitness Coach". I alternate between the two - which works well.

Wii Fit - I like doing aroung 45 minutes:
10 minutes rhythm boxing
5 minutes advanced step
10 minutes super hula hoop
5 minutes island lap run
5 minutes yoga
5 minutes training
5 minutes ski jumping or slalom skiing.

I vary the order, and occasionally throw in some of the other exercises.
